My divorce made me face this coveting subject.  My jewish Bible illustrates by saying you don't covet lady Diana, cause you can't have her, not possible or some other queen like lady.  But your exwife you know everything about her so it makes you crazy to know she is with someone else.

Paul might have been divorced.  He does not say.  But the topic comes up in Romans 7 and I Corinthians 7.

Paul said he kept all the law except he was coveting in Romans 7, the one heart attitude.  No one else saw it but he knew it.  The law even made it worse somehow.  So he had an internal struggle.  He ended up realizing he needed grace and one law to be overcome by another law in Romans 8.

The pain of divorce can invigorate you spiritually or it can lead to infected spiritual wounds from stumbling.  It is important to take time to be single and whole and avoid rebound relationships as they say in Divorce Care support groups.
